About 405 W 17th St

This nostalgic home is original pier and beam set on a property that was sub divided into four lots in 2017. There are an abundance of windows allowing for a bounty of natural light. Many updates including electrical panel, kitchen and bathroom, original wood floor restoration, updated lighting, plumbing fixtures, countertops, appliances privacy fence, back porch, and more. Remodeled bathroom with double sinks and generous walk in shower. Garage conversion has mini-split HVAC with separate carport entrance. The bonus room can be converted back to a garage or extended carport. Plenty of backyard space with mature pecan and peach trees to gather, garden, or unwind. This property provides a rare opportunity to embrace the past while adding your own personal touches, a serene retreat and convenient access to vibrant local attractions, dining, and shopping. Convenient to parks, Blue Hole, Downtown and all that Historic Georgetown has to offer. No HOA. High end kitchen appliances included.

Living in Georgetown, TX

Georgetown's transportation infrastructure supports both private and public transit options. The city offers a bus service with a schedule designed to accommodate commuters and local travelers. Ride-sharing services are available, enhancing mobility within the city. Georgetown is also characterized by areas that are pedestrian-friendly, encouraging walking and biking. The road network includes well-maintained highways that facilitate travel to nearby cities and regions, with ongoing plans to improve transport efficiency and accessibility for residents.

The community is served by a range of essential services, including a network of public schools that cater to students from kindergarten through high school. Georgetown also boasts several private educational institutions, some with religious affiliations, offering alternative schooling options. Healthcare is readily accessible, with facilities providing a spectrum of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The city's public library system supports lifelong learning and community engagement, while the retail and dining landscape reflects the local culture and caters to a variety of tastes.

Georgetown prides itself on its rich historical roots and vibrant community spirit. The city's downtown area is particularly celebrated for its beautifully preserved Victorian architecture and the bustling town square, which hosts a variety of local events and festivals throughout the year. These gatherings not only showcase the area's cultural identity but also foster a strong sense of community among residents.

Georgetown's housing market is diverse, offering a mix of single-family homes, apartments, and townhouses to accommodate various preferences. The architectural styles in the area are varied, with a notable presence of modern and traditional designs. Single-family homes are the most common, providing a suburban feel to the community. The homeownership rate in Georgetown is robust, reflecting a community invested in property and stability.
